Peabody Energy (BTU) reported a Q2 2026 loss per share of -$0.60, well below the analyst consensus estimate of -$0.3837, representing a negative surprise of -56.37%. Specific revenue figures were not disclosed in this data set. Despite the significant earnings miss, the stock advanced 5.77%, suggesting investors may have focused on other aspects of the report.

Peabody Energy's second-quarter 2026 results revealed a challenging operating environment, with the company reporting a diluted EPS loss of -$0.60. This marked a meaningful shortfall against the Street's -$0.3837 projection, translating to a negative surprise of roughly 56.37%. While specific revenue figures were not provided, the magnitude of the miss points to mounting cost pressures across the company's mining portfolio. Thermal coal markets continued to face headwinds from softer demand and price volatility, while seaborne metallurgical coal pricing may have offered only a partial offset. The company's U.S. thermal operations likely experienced margin compression as elevated input costs—including diesel, explosives, and labor—pressured realized pricing. Meanwhile, the seaborne segment may have benefited from improved logistics but remained subject to dynamic global supply conditions. The reported loss underscores elevated cost structures and subdued pricing that weighed heavily on the bottom line during the quarter. Additionally, any one-time charges or operational disruptions could have contributed to the earnings shortfall, although such details were not available in this release. Overall, the quarter highlights the persistent margin challenges facing coal producers amid a softer pricing backdrop.

Looking ahead, Peabody management may provide updated guidance reflecting prevailing market conditions, though none was detailed in this data set. The company could continue to prioritize cost discipline and productivity improvements across its mine portfolio as a hedge against softer coal prices. Strategic priorities may include optimizing production volumes across its Powder River Basin and seaborne operations, as well as disciplined capital allocation toward debt reduction and shareholder returns. Risks persist, including potential further declines in thermal coal demand due to mild weather conditions and competition from cheaper natural gas and renewables. Additionally, volatility in seaborne metallurgical coal prices could affect future margins. Management might also explore export opportunities to mitigate soft domestic demand and rebalance inventory levels. While the stock rallied 5.77% following the print, investors should temper expectations, as a sustained recovery in earnings may depend on firmer coal price realizations and greater operational stability. The company anticipates navigating these uncertain conditions with an emphasis on liquidity preservation and balance sheet strength, though the exact trajectory of the coal market remains hard to predict.

Recognizing patterns helps anticipate possible moves. Despite the substantial EPS miss, BTU shares advanced 5.77% in the trading session following the announcement. This counterintuitive move may reflect investor expectations that the loss was driven largely by transitory factors, or that management's broader commentary pointed to a stabilizing cost environment. Analysts may be scrutinizing the disconnect between the wider-than-expected loss and the positive price action, potentially attributing the rally to positioning, short covering, or a relief rally after recent weakness. Some sell-side commentary might view the downside as already priced into the stock. Investment implications remain cautious; while the rally signals some degree of relief, underlying earnings quality is weak. Investors should watch for a detailed reconciliation of the EPS shortfall, including any non-recurring charges, as well as management's outlook on full-year costs. Commentary on coal demand from key importers such as China and India, along with port logistics and export pricing trends, will also be critical to monitor. The next meaningful catalyst could be updates on production adjustments or asset rationalization efforts. With fundamentals still soft, the stock's direction may hinge more on broader coal market sentiment than on the reported loss itself.
